Source S2, S3, S4
Branches None
Sensory External genitalia
Motor Muscles of the perineum and external anal sphincter

The pudendal nerve travels with the pudendal artery, leaves the pelvis between the piriformis and coccygeus muscle,

and enters the perineum through the lesser sciatic foramen.
